Continental Carbon Shares Surge on Strong Foreign Buying and Increased Volume

Process Industries · Chemicals: Specialty · economic_daily · 2026-09-09

2104

Continental Carbon (2104) saw its share price rally by 6.93% on the 9th, supported by a surge in trading volume and renewed investor interest in its growth potential.

What Happened

Stock Performance: Continental Carbon shares opened flat but gained momentum throughout the session, closing at 10.8 TWD for a 6.93% daily increase. The stock reached an intraday high of 10.95 TWD as buying pressure intensified.

Trading Volume: The company experienced a significant spike in trading activity, with total volume reaching 10,226 shares. This surge in volume helped absorb market supply and provided a solid foundation for the price rally.

Market Sentiment: Increased foreign investment has bolstered confidence in the company's growth trajectory. Investors are closely monitoring the stock as it shows signs of emerging momentum in the current market environment.

Outlook: The combination of rising prices and expanded volume suggests a positive shift in market sentiment. Analysts will be watching to see if this trend continues to support further upside potential for the stock.
